Because the original game requires an active connection to EA servers that no longer exist, users often download "patched" or "modded" versions designed to bypass this server check and enable offline gameplay. Common Fixes for "Server Error" on Android

If you are trying to install a patched version of FIFA 16, follow these general steps found in community tutorials like those on YouTube:

Extract Zip Files Properly: These patches typically include three components: an APK (the app), an OBB file (large game data), and a Data file (player stats/settings). Correct File Placement:

Move the extracted OBB folder to: Internal Storage > Android > obb.

Move the extracted Data folder to: Internal Storage > Android > data.

Clear App Data: If you see a "Server Error" after installation, go to Settings > Apps > FIFA 16 > Storage and select Clear Data. This often resets the game’s attempt to reach defunct servers and forces it to read the patched offline files instead. fix+server+fifa+16+zip+file+download+android+patched

Wait on the Loading Screen: Some patches require you to wait on the main menu for at least 30 seconds to a minute before tapping to start, which can bypass certain initial connection checks.

Bypass Android Permissions: On Android 12, 13, and 14, you may need a specific file explorer like ZArchiver to bypass folder access restrictions in the Android/data directory. Guide: How to Install FIFA 16 Modded/Patched Versions on Android

Most "FIFA 16" downloads for Android are actually mods of FIFA 14 (which was the last offline-native FIFA game for mobile). These mods update kits, logos, stadiums, and sometimes gameplay mechanics to simulate the FIFA 16 experience.

Step 2: Understand the File Types

You mentioned a "zip file." Usually, these downloads come in two parts:

  1. The APK File: This is the application installer (usually small, around 30MB - 100MB).
  2. The OBB/Data File: This contains the graphics, commentary, and player data. This is the large file (often 1GB+) that comes in a ZIP or RAR format.
